Please remember that the traditional wedding vow does specify that the marriage will last, "until death do us part". Marriage is not intended to last even beyond the grave. A widower is entitled to remarry. It does not constitute infidelity to the deceased wife.

After a person's death, their marriage legally ends. The surviving spouse is considered a widow or widower.
